title image


Smiley Alle Datensätze anstsatt nur die "gefilterten"
Hallo

Ich brauche dringend Hilfe.

Mir ergibt es keinen Sinn warum das nicht funktioniert wie ich es gedacht habe..



Beschreibung:

comname = Ein Kombifeld, bei welchem man den Kurs auswählen kann

comdat = Ein Kombifeld, bei welchem die Kursdetails, des ausgewählten

Kursus von comname übergeben werden sollten.



Problem :

es werden alle Datensätze der Tabelle Kursdetails im comdat angezeigt und nicht nur die , die in der Tabelle Kurs mit dem Kursnamen verknüpft sind.





Private Sub Detailbereich_Click()

Dim rst, rst1 As DAO.Recordset

Dim semname, strText



semname = Me.comname.Column(3)

MsgBox semname

Set rst = CurrentDb.OpenRecordset("SELECT F_KD FROM Kurs WHERE F_KN = '" & semname & "'")

If rst.RecordCount > 0 Then



Set rst1 = CurrentDb.OpenRecordset("SELECT * FROM Kursdetails WHERE Kd_ID = " & rst)

Me!comdat = rst1

End If



End Sub



(Nun habe ich mir Mühe gegeben!)
Gruss aus der Schweiz
derb (aka Copy Hans Bärbel)

Nur mit dem Unmöglichen als Ziel kommt man zum Möglichen!


Miguel de Unamuno (1864-1936)
span. Schriftsteller
Nobelpreis für Literatur
(\_/)
(O.o)
(> < ) This is Bunny. Copy Bunny into your signature to help him on his way to world domination.

geschrieben von

Login

E-Mail:
  

Passwort:
  

Beitrag anfügen

Symbol:
 
 
 
 
 
 
 
 
 
 
 
 
 

Überschrift: